Where we go from here is ditch 352.  It's system that requires very good players.  At the back it requires one centre half and either side players of real pace who can cover the full back positions - not three big slow centre halves like we have.  The wing backs also need to be really fast and able to cover the full length of the pitch for 90 minutes - ours can't. In short we haven't got the players to play this system - and because of that we are vunerable to a team like Crewe who exploit us down the flanks.
